Planning a Bali Vacation? Tucked away amidst the lush greenery of Bali, you’ll find a real hidden treasure, Leke Leke Waterfall! It is situated in the Tabanan Regency, about 40 km north of Ubud, offering a peaceful retreat from crowded tourist spots.

Surrounded by dense tropical rainforest, Leke Leke Waterfall in Bali provides a serene and picturesque setting, with clear water flowing down a narrow cliff into a tranquil pool below.

Not as famous as other waterfalls in Bali, Leke Leke has its own special charm and exclusivity. Its name, “Leke Leke,” comes from the Balinese word “leke,” which means “hidden,” perfectly capturing the secluded nature of the waterfall.

Leke Leke Waterfall In Bali Tourist Information

blog-images
  • Leke Leke Waterfall Height: 30-32 metres approx
  • Trek Difficulty: Easy to Moderate
  • Trek Duration: 15 to 30 minutes one way
  • Entrance Fee: ₹258/- per person
  • Parking Fee: ₹10/- per two wheeler, ₹22/- per four wheeler
  • Facilities: Parking, Changing rooms, and Toilets
  • Opening Hours: 8 AM to 5 PM
  • Location: Mekarsari, Tabanan Regency, Bali, Indonesia

Leke Leke Waterfall Hike

blog-images

The Leke Leke waterfall hike is an adventure deep into Bali’s natural beauty. The trail is relatively easy and suitable for all ages, but it requires a moderate level of fitness due to some uneven and steep sections.

The trail is well-marked and maintained for a safe and enjoyable hike. The Leke Leke waterfall hike starts at the parking area near a small ticket booth.

Then, follow a narrow path through dense vegetation, crossing bamboo bridges and streams. The sound of the waterfall gets louder as you get closer, building excitement for the breathtaking sight that awaits you.

During the hike, you’ll see tropical plants, flowers, and occasional glimpses of wildlife like birds and butterflies. The hike usually takes around 15-30 minutes, depending on your pace and how often you stop to enjoy the scenery and take photos. Trekking here is one of the best things to do in Bali.

What Is The Best Time To Visit Leke Leke Waterfall In Bali

blog-images

Let’s explore the best time to visit Leke Leke Waterfall in Bali below:

Dry Season - April To October

The best time to visit Bali’s Leke Leke Waterfall is during the dry season, which runs from April to October. During this period, the weather is generally sunny and dry, making the trek to the waterfall Leke Leke more comfortable, and the water will be clearer for swimming and photography.

Visiting in the early morning or late afternoon can also enhance your experience. These times of the day are usually less crowded, allowing you to enjoy the tranquillity of the waterfall. Additionally, the lighting during these times is ideal for photography.

Wet Season - March To November

During the wet season from March to November, waterfalls transform dramatically. Heavy rainfall increases water volume, creating more powerful and visually appealing scenery with lush landscapes.

However, this beauty comes with risks like rocks becoming slippery, water currents growing stronger, and flash floods occurring unexpectedly. Leeches may be present in the surrounding areas as well, causing potential safety risks.

Tips For Visiting Leke Leke Waterfall

blog-images

Here are simple travel tips for visiting Leke Leke Waterfall:

Before You Go

  • Leke Leke Waterfall to Ubud takes about 1.5 to 2 hours by scooter or private driver.
  • The Leke Leke waterfall entrance fee is ₹258/- per person, and you need to pay with cash.
  • Go early in the morning to avoid crowds and get better photos.

What to Wear & Bring

  • Wear strong shoes that dry fast and have a good grip because the path is slippery.
  • Wear clothes that dry quickly and bring a colorful swimsuit for nice photos.
  • Bring water, snacks, bug spray, and a towel if you want to swim.
  • Use a special camera lens and a tripod to take better waterfall pictures.

The Hike & Waterfall

  • The walk to the waterfall takes about 15 to 30 minutes, but it can be steep and slippery.
  • The waterfall is beautiful, but it gets busy, so wait for your turn for photo spots.
  • Don't throw trash anywhere, and keep the area clean for everyone.
